Top 5 Tabletop Board Games Apps in Latvia for Q4 2022

In the fourth quarter of 2022, the top 5 tabletop board game apps in Latvia showed varied performance in terms of downloads and revenue. Below, we explore how each app fared during this period.

Chess - Play and Learn from Chess.com saw a notable increase in weekly downloads, peaking at approximately 1.7K in the week of December 19. The app's weekly revenue also showed a steady rise, reaching around $296 in the final week of December.

Checkers Online by CC Games experienced a gradual increase in weekly downloads, peaking at about 592 during the week of December 26. Revenue for this app remained minimal, with occasional increments of $1.

Sea Battle 2 from Byril had a relatively stable performance in terms of weekly downloads, with numbers fluctuating around 200-300. Weekly revenue for the app saw minor fluctuations, peaking at approximately $36 in the last week of December.

Checkers - Online & Offline by GamoVation showed a consistent trend in weekly downloads, reaching around 255 in the final week of December. The app's revenue saw minor peaks, with the highest being around $11 in the week of November 21.

Whooo? from Yso Corp had an inconsistent pattern in weekly downloads, peaking at approximately 261 in the week of December 26. The app did not generate any significant revenue during this period.
